Transaction 381149bba6294912dd2fbdd83f20b113d6b0c3cf2a9eb55a66c5a80e7f029d53
1 Input
1 Output
-
381149bba6294912dd2fbdd83f20b113d6b0c3cf2a9eb55a66c5a80e7f029d53:0
- value
- 457681
- script pubkey
- OP_0 OP_PUSHBYTES_20 95daf8e180c44b9c41a436390af8ca4dcac17777
- address
- bc1qjhd03cvqc39ecsdyxcus47x2fh9vzamhjavz0x